Luke_B_123 Posted March 21, 2018 Share Posted March 21, 2018 Yes love the golf! The WGC matchplay starts today. Good field. 16 groups Teeing off around 3pm today (it's in Austin, Texas) Rahms Group, Rorys group, Days group and Spieths group all look really tasty. Oost is big value at 60/1 as he seems. To overperform in match plays, but has Jason day in his group and even if he gets past him is likely to Meet the winner of Group 1 (presumably Dustin Johnson) if he goes through. And that's before getting near the places paid. The format of this competition is one through out of each group, then last 16 onwards is just a head to head knockout. Groups 1, 4, 5, 8, 9, 12, 13 and 16 are in the one half of the bracket, with the other groups in the other. This makes it a little more difficult than usual to pick an outsider, as its head to head to the final, playing solid all the way through rather than blowing hot and cold is going to be key.
